NOTES
  1. Version 1.1, November 6 2023. This calculator is based on ASHRAE 2018 Refrigeration manual data and is provided to assist AboveAir Technologies's partners in sizing refrigerant piping. All other use prohibited.
  2. Suction line sizing based on 2°F change in saturation temperature, discharge line sizing based on 1°F change in saturation temperature, liquid line sizing based on 1°F change in saturation temperature.
  3. 90° elbows are long-radius. For standard radius elbows, substitute quantity (2) 45° elbows.
  4. Use discharge gas line sizing for field-installed hot gas reheat lines.
  5. Size piping for fixed speed and digital scroll compressors for 100% of their maximum circuit capacity.
  6. Size piping for 2-Stage compressors for 66.7% of their maximum circuit capacity.
